This group of examples shows how to add, show, and delete a certificate in the SSL store.
In the following example, the user types the set ssl command, using the /i, /h, and /g parameters to specify the IP address, Thumbprint hash, and GUID, respectively, for the certificate being added.
httpcfg set ssl /i 10.0.0.1:80 /h 2c8bfddf59a4a51a2a5b6186c22473108295624d /g "{2bb50d9c-7f6a-4d6f-873d-5aee7fb43290}"
After running the command, Httpcfg displays the following text on the screen to confirm the command completed without an error (error code of 0).
HttpSetServiceConfiguration completed with 0.
In this example, the user first types the query ssl command with the /i parameter, specifying an IP address in order to view the meta-information for a particular certificate. Following that, the user types query ssl without the /i paremeter, to view all certificates in the store.
httpcfg query ssl
IP : 10.0.0.13:80
Hash : 2c8bfddf59a4a51a2a5b6186c22473108295624d
Guid : {2bb50d9c-7f6a-4d6f-873d-5aee7fb43290}
CertStoreName : (null)
CertCheckMode : 0
RevocationFreshnessTime : 0
UrlRetrievalTimeout : 0
SslCtlIdentifier : (null)
SslCtlStoreName : (null)
Flags : 0
------------------------------------------------------------------------------
IP : 10.0.0.1:80
Hash : 2c8bfddf59a4a51a2a5b6186c22473108295624d
Guid : {2bb50d9c-7f6a-4d6f-873d-5aee7fb43290}
CertStoreName : (null)
CertCheckMode : 0
RevocationFreshnessTime : 0
UrlRetrievalTimeout : 0
SslCtlIdentifier : (null)
SslCtlStoreName : (null)
Flags : 0
------------------------------------------------------------------------------
In this example, the user types delete ssl with the required /i parameter to delete the associated certificate record from the SSL store.
httpcfg delete ssl /i 10.0.0.1:80
Httpcgf then displays the following text to the screen, verifying that the command completed successfully (error code of 0).
HttpDeleteServiceConfiguration completed with 0.
This group of examples show how to add, remove, and view URL ACL combinations in the urlacl store.
httpcfg set urlacl /u https://woodgrovebank.com:443/ /a "O:DAG:DAD:(A;;GRGX;;;DA)(A;;GA;;;BA)"
HttpSetServiceConfiguration completed with 0.
httpcfg query urlacl
URL : https://woodgrovebank.com:443/
ACL : O:DAG:DAD:(A;;GXGR;;;DA)(A;;GA;;;BA)
------------------------------------------------------------------------------
URL : https://woodgrovebank.com:80/
ACL : O:DAG:DAD:(A;;CCDC;;;SY)(A;;CCDC;;;DA)(OA;;CCDC;bf967aba-0de6-11d0-a285-00aa003049e2;;AO)(OA;;CCDC;bf967a9c-0d
e6-11d0-a285-00aa003049e2;;AO)(OA;;CCDC;6da8a4ff-0e52-11d0-a286-00aa003049e2;;AO)(OA;;CCDC;bf967aa8-0de6-11d0-a285-00aa0
03049e2;;PO)(A;;;;;AU)S:(AU;SAFA;CCDCSWWPSDWDWO;;;WD)
------------------------------------------------------------------------------
httpcfg delete urlacl /u https://woodgrovebank.com:80/
HttpDeleteServiceConfiguration completed with 0.
httpcfg iplisten
This group of examples show how to add, delete, and list IP address in the iplisten store.
Adding an IP address to the iplisten store.
httpcfg set iplisten -i 10.0.0.1:80
HttpSetServiceConfiguration completed with 0.
Viewing all off the IP addresses that the HTTP API is listening on.
httpcfg query iplisten
IP : 10.0.0.1:80
------------------------------------------------------------------------------
IP : 10.0.0.13:80
------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Shows the result of deleting a record from the iplisten store.
httpcfg delete iplisten -i 10.0.0.1:80
HttpDeleteServiceConfiguration completed with 0.
